Congress grants FDA oversight of tobacco
Congress gave final approval June 12 to legislation authorizing the Food and Drug Administration to regulate tobacco products.
The House of Representatives voted 307-97 for the Family Smoking Prevention and Tobacco Control Act a day after the Senate passed the same bill in a 79-17 roll call. more »
